The Sky Lords were a group of drones sent to kill Felicity Smoak by her "nemesis". They were able to fly, and could fire missiles from various points on their bodies.


The Sky Lords were sent to Palmer Technologies to eliminate Felicity Smoak. She was dropped off of the 50-story building, but quickly saved by The Flash.[1] They followed The Flash, who was carrying Felicity, to a wind farm. They launched torpedoes at them, but missed, and The Flash proceeded to confuse them and then destroy them, unmasking one to reveal that it was a drone.[2]



The Flash: Season Zero


  1. Smoak Signals part 1
  2. Smoak Signals part 2